This Standard specifies requirements for hydraulic cements consisting of portland cement or of mixtures of portland cement and one or more of fly ash, ground granulated iron blast-furnace slag or silica fume.It does not purport to provide for all the requirements which may be needed in specific applications of such cements.NOTE: Background information on the development of this Standard as a performance-based specification of cement is given in Appendix A.

First published in part as AS A2-1925.Second edition AS A2-1926.Third edtion 1937.Fourth edition 1938.Fifth edition 1948.Sixth edition 1953.Seventh edition 1963.AS A181 first published 1971.Revised and redesignated AS 1317-1972.AS A2-1963 revised and redesignated AS 1315-1973.AS A2-1963 withdrawn 1976.AS A181-1971 withdrawn 1976.AS 1315-1973 revised in part as AS 1315-1982.Second edition AS 1317-1982.AS 1315-1982 and AS 1317-1982 revised, amalgmated and redesignated AS 3972-1991.Second edition 1997.
